Q. What is a good size for my water feature?
    A. The size of your water feature is largely a personal preference and based on the area or amount of space you have available and the financial limits you set for the project. It will also depend on your use for the water feature. Will it be a water garden? Or will you want to add fish? Is it a Koi breeding pond or a formal fountain? A qualified professional can help to determine what size will fit your needs, lifestyle and budget, but remember, the number one answer customers give if asked what they would change about their water feature is ‘size’, they all wish it were larger. When first planned, a water feature appears large enough and then you add a few fish and plants and the next thing you know, it’s full and you will want more room to grow.

Q. How deep should my water feature be?
    A. The depth will correspond with overall size and function or use of your water feature. If you intend on displaying aquatic plants, a shallower pool will suffice. If you would like to introduce fish into your pond, you will need a much deeper water feature. Local building codes will play a part in determining how deep an open body of water can be without being fenced in. Q. What about mosquito’s, algae and other pests?
    A. The water feature industry is growing so rapidly right now because of unparalleled popularity. Water features are the number one item a home owner would like to add to their property. Because of this, companies are producing wonderful new components and equipment for your ornamental pond. One of the greatest advances is the use of ultraviolet sterilization units in ornamental water features. These units can completely eliminate parasites, bacteria, mosquito larvae and green water algae in your pond leaving you with clean, clear, pristine water.
